About Market Cap
As of the previous market close, Cognizant Technology Solutions Corporation has a market cap of $35.37B, which represents its share price of $71.76 multiplied by its outstanding shares number of 492.94M. As a large-cap company, CTSH's shareholders are generally exposed to less risk than shareholders of small and mid-cap companies.
The company's Market Capitalization is a measurement of company size. It is calculation of the company's share price times the number of outstanding shares. Large market cap companies give stability and are good long-term investments. Small market cap companies can produce faster growth and bigger returns, but their stockholders are exposed to more risk.
